While Codsall may not boast the plethora of amenities seen at larger stations, it efficiently caters to essential travel needs. With no ticket office in place, visitors can conveniently use ticket machines to collect pre-purchased tickets. However, it's important to note that the ticket machines aren't accessible. There’s a helpful induction loop available for those requiring auditory assistance, ensuring an inclusive travel experience.
Those needing assistance at Codsall Station should be aware that there is an absence of onsite staff help. However, travelers can rely on the customer help points for guidance and emergency needs. Furthermore, the station lacks facilities such as waiting rooms, toilets, refreshment areas, and CCTV, keeping its setup minimalistic yet functional.
Accessibility is a key component of Codsall Station's ethos, providing partial step-free access. Wheelchair users and individuals with mobility impairments can make use of steps and ramps, although the station does lack waiting room facilities and accessible toilets. Assistance in boarding the train can be requested by attracting the attention of the conductor from the designated meeting point. Those needing further guidance can confidently request assistance via Passenger Assist services anytime before the journey commences. Gainsborough Central lacks a traditional ticket office, but rest easy knowing that there are ticket machines available to collect your tickets. This station is equipped with accessible ticket machines, ensuring that everyone has ease of access at the station entrance. While staff assistance isn't available here, passengers are encouraged to use the helpline at 08002006060 or wait for conductors upon train arrival. For those concerned about step-free access, the station is scooter-friendly and provides ramps to both platforms. If you're planning on assistance, consider utilizing the Passenger Assist service via the National Rail website.
Enthralling visiting this destination doesn't stop at the train station, and with several onward travel options, you'll find it convenient to kick-off any adventure. Rail replacement services can be located at the entrance to the station car park, offering an invaluable backup on those days when train services might be compromised. Furthermore, taxis can be quickly arranged by visiting this link. For those looking to make use of the local bus network, the bus station is a short 750 yards away on Heaton Street, making local travel connections a breeze.
